Login and logout behavior
You can log in to DISCO from a URL that is specific to an organization, matter, or database. Or, you can log in from the default DISCO URL: https://login.csdisco.com/.
To log out of DISCO, click the user profile icon and then click Log out.
DISCO will automatically log you out after two hours of inactivity.
Landing on Matters
Upon logging into DISCO, users will land in their organization's Matters page.
If a user has access to multiple organizations, they will simply land in their primary organization represented in their user account settings.
In the image above, you can see that the user is currently on the Matters page for the DISCO LLC organization.
If you are unsure which organization is indicated as your primary, simply click on the user profile icon in the primary navigation to open the Account settings modal. There you will find the organization listed. See image below.
Navigating across organizations
Users will now have the ability to easily navigate across organizations to access their work through the new menu located in the primary navigation.
When clicking on the menu, users will see the list of organizations they have access to in addition to the current organization they are working in.
In the image above, you can see this user is currently in the DISCO LLC organization, but also has access to Cecilia Corp and CS DISCO.
When a user clicks on an organization from the menu, they will be navigated to the Matters page for that organization. From there, users can quickly access each of the matters they have access to within the organization.
Navigation menus within review and case database
Similar to the Matters landing page, within review and case database users have access to a menu within the primary navigation.
By clicking on the name of the review database, a menu will open displaying the organization and matter information. Simply click the organization to return back to the Matters page.

System Status Banners
You may have noticed a big red banner at the very most top of your database.
This red banner is displayed to keep our customers informed of when they can expect an outage. The reason for the outage is one of two things: routine maintenance or migrating to a more up to date version of DISCO.
Routine maintenance
Routine maintenance is done in order to maintain system performance, reliability, security, and stability of the DISCO infrastructure. We will run routine maintenance jobs every so often during the life of a database or if we make a substantive change to our software architecture.
Migrating to a more up-to-date version of DISCO
DISCO will shut down your database briefly in order to upgrade your database to be housed in our most up to date version.
Preparing for outage
We give our clients one week's notice before a scheduled outage. Each outage usually happens between 8pm-6am.
The red banner will display the starting date of the outage as well as a countdown to the exact second it starts.
Rescheduling your outage
Contact DISCO Support. We would be happy to reschedule your outage at a more convenient time. However, there will be times your outage is mandatory and cannot be rescheduled.
